To be precise, the desire to show Buren’s family, who were both incompetent and criminal, their place was greater, but this was also no lie, so she answered confidently.

Then Asphayren smiled, pulling up one corner of his mouth.

…Scary face.

‘A, a mocking smile…? Did I say something wrong?’

Cold sweat poured down. But it was an unnecessary worry. Because.

“You, what’s your name?”

“!!”

Afterward, Asphayren asked me my name.

My word, he’s asking my name!

Asphayren, who doesn’t even remember existence, let alone names, if uninterested, in person! Directly!

This must be a positive curiosity about me even if I look at it with fear!

‘It’s a success!’

The strategy of capturing Asphayren’s ideal subject image hit the mark perfectly!

I cheered with victory in my mind.

‘As expected of Jinnoran~ Our As’s male otaku~. Godlike Jinnoran who knows better about Asphayren than anyone else, hooray!’

And I smiled broadly, ready to say my name, but…

…Upon reflection, I didn’t have a name to say. I couldn’t give the outofplace name “Jinnoran” here either.

In the end, I brought up the story of ‘this body’s original owner.

“Um, I don’t have a name.”

“You don’t have a name?”

“Yes. That is…….”

Thus, the tragic story of the nameless girl unfolded. Memory loss, treatment in the village, the process of being offered as a sacrifice.

As soon as the brief story was over, Asphayren nodded his head.

“I see. I understand. Then, Lumel.”

“Yes, my lord.”

“Take good care of this woman. Give her what she needs. She’s a valuable witness, so she should be treated accordingly.”

“I will follow your command.”

Lumel bowed his head respectfully. Now Asphayren looked at me.

“Stay here for now. If everything you said is proven true, I will reward you then.”

“Yes!”

Asphayren, who smiled a scary smile that seemed like a sneer, then left the room.

I sat down on the floor, letting out a deflated sound.

For the time being, I can stay here.

Three days later, in Lord Loarkin’s office.

“Sir Ulysses’s letter has arrived.”

A sharplooking woman with ashcolored hair tinted with violet, braided to the side, extended a tray with a letter to Asphayren.

Her name was Kiara Gordo. She was Asphayren’s chief aide.

As Asphayren picked up the letter, Kiara added an explanation.

“All the words of that witness were true. A total of 52 popuris containing denunciations were found in Buren’s territory and a few surrounding territories.”

“52?”

“Remarkable!”
Standing behind Asphayren, a man with dark reddishbrown hair, dressed in a knight’s uniform, exclaimed in a resonant voice.

He was Canis, the commander of the Loarkin Lord’s guard.

“How could he have made all that alone? Especially in a situation where he would soon die. The willpower is truly amazing.”

“Indeed.”

Asphayren lightly agreed. Kiara and Canis widened their eyes and looked at each other in response to the unusual reaction.

‘Apparently, the Lord thinks more highly of that witness than expected?’

Such thoughts exchanged in their glances, quickly passing between them.

Whether his closest associates were surprised or not, Asphayren, with a sullen face, tore open the letter.

In Ulysses’ handwritten letter, there was a brief description of how he had brought down the Buren family using the indictment.

Asphayren, who quickly skimmed the first page, muttered,

“It seems the indictment was helpful.”

“Yes. Thanks to the indictment, we started the search on time and found evidence that the door had been forcibly opened and closed. We also persuaded the residents of the nearby village, including Sosori Village, where the sacrificial ritual took place, and obtained testimony.”

Listening to Kiara’s additional explanation, Asphayren turned the letter to the next page.

“The youngest son of the Buren family, who led the sacrificial ritual, and the head of the family who knew and yet condoned it, were beheaded, and their heads were hung at the city gates. The other direct relatives and collaterals, vassals, were stripped of their property and nobility status……”

“And the residents of Sosori Village were sentenced to maximum death, minimum 10 years of labor depending on the degree of complicity and willingness to testify.”

“He acted strongly.”

Asphayren lifted one corner of his mouth and folded the letter back to its original state, placing it on the tray.

He showed a strong example of what happens if human sacrifices are offered, so now there should be no one to oppose Ulysses.

The case was closed.

“Ulysses must have been very pleased.”

“Yes.”

So delighted that he probably hit his poor wife with a slap and wagged his tail vigorously.

Recalling the way Ulysses often appeared in front of him, Asphayren frowned.

Kiara then asked Asphayren,

“So, what will you do with that witness now? Will you send her back?”

At those words, Asphayren’s hand hesitated.

Send her back, he said.

Asphayren thought of the woman who would now be writhing in her hospital room.

A small frame, round head with short reddishbrown hair dangling around her chin and jaw. Pale cheeks flushed with feverish pink and naivelooking round eyes.

And those bright brown pupils that sparkled golden every time she defiantly raised her head, that nameless woman.

Ulysses’ letter said that if he sent the woman to Grancia, he would reward her himself.

Ulysses wouldn’t skimp on the reward, so she would surely be able to live comfortably for the rest of her life.

Besides, the woman was originally from Elvas. So, it should have been a matter of saying to send her back as soon as she recovered.

For some reason, he was reluctant to do so.
